UK - This new bioplastic was created by student Lucy Hughes and is made from fishing waste, such as fish scales and algae

New Mexico - Architect Michael Reynolds uses garbage like recycled tires and bottles to build fully functional homes. The houses also utilise solar energy.

Amsterdam - As a rider bikes around, the spinning wheel stores kinetic energy in batteries. When the bike is parked at this special rack, energy flows out to the area's electric grid.
